Power Your Speakers With the Right Amplifier
Amplification is essential when you're trying to get maximum performance from aftermarket speakers. A properly matched amplifier provides cleaner power and greater headroom than many factory stereos.
When pairing an amplifier with apocalypse 6x9 speakers, compare RMS power handling, impedance, sensitivity, and amplifier output.
RMS ratings are generally more useful than peak wattage when matching components. The goal is to provide clean, controlled power rather than simply choosing the amplifier with the biggest numbers.

Add a Subwoofer for Deeper Bass
While powerful full-range speakers can produce impressive mid-bass, a dedicated subwoofer is still the best solution for very low frequencies.
A subwoofer allows the main speakers to focus on vocals, instruments, and midrange frequencies while handling deep bass separately.
This combination can create a more complete soundstage and prevent the main speakers from being pushed beyond their most efficient range.
Use Sound Deadening to Control Vibrations
Loud audio can expose unwanted vibrations in vehicle doors, panels, and trim. These vibrations can create rattles that distract from your music.
Sound-deadening materials can help reduce panel resonance and some road noise. Treating areas around the speaker mounting locations can also create a more controlled environment for apocalypse 6x9 speakers.
The result can be cleaner playback with fewer distracting rattles at higher listening levels.
Proper Installation Is Essential
Even premium speakers can underperform when they're installed incorrectly. A secure mounting surface helps prevent vibration and ensures the speaker can operate effectively.
During installation:
- Use the correct mounting adapter.
- Secure the speaker firmly.
- Check speaker polarity.
- Use appropriately sized wiring.
- Seal gaps around the mounting surface where appropriate.
- Keep wiring protected from heat and moving components.
Taking care of these details can make a noticeable difference in system performance.
Upgrade Your Car Audio Wiring
Wiring is an important part of any high-performance system. Power cables should be sized according to amplifier requirements, while speaker cables should be appropriate for the system's power and impedance.
A clean installation should also include secure grounds, properly protected power connections, and suitable fuse protection.

Tune Your System for Everyday Listening
A powerful system doesn't need to run at maximum volume all the time. Proper tuning helps maintain enjoyable sound at both moderate and higher listening levels.
Adjusting the following can improve overall performance:
- Equalizer settings
- Amplifier gain
- Crossover points
- Speaker balance
- Subwoofer level
- Phase
- Time alignment
If your system includes a DSP, you can make more precise adjustments to improve sound staging and frequency balance.
